Product Manager (NPI) - Gas Sensing

Product Manager (NPI) - Gas Sensing is a senior role responsible for overseeing and driving the success of the company's products. This position combines deep product knowledge with strategic oversight, leadership, and cross‑functional collaboration to enhance product performance, meet market demands, and support overall business objectives.

Key Responsibilities
  • NPI Project Management – Lead or supervise new product introduction process. Coordinate with cross‑functional teams to ensure the timely and successful launch of new products.
  • Strategic Planning – Support strategies for new product introductions that align with market needs and business goals. Provide insights and recommendations based on market research and competitive analysis.
  • Cross‑Functional Coordination – Collaborate with R&D, manufacturing, marketing, sales, and supply chain teams to ensure alignment and integration of new products. Facilitate effective communication and resolve any issues that arise.
  • Technical Expertise – Provide technical support and guidance throughout the NPI process. Address complex technical issues and ensure that new products meet quality and performance standards.
  • Product Validation – Support product testing and validation activities to ensure compliance with specifications and regulatory requirements. Identify and address any issues that arise during testing.
  • Market Readiness – Collaborate with marketing and sales teams to ensure that new products are well‑positioned in the market and supported with appropriate training and materials.
  • Documentation and Reporting – Maintain comprehensive documentation related to new product introductions. Prepare and present reports on project status, performance metrics, and strategic recommendations.
  • Customer and Stakeholder Engagement – Engage with customers and stakeholders to gather feedback on new products. Utilize feedback to drive product improvements and enhance customer satisfaction.
  • Issue Resolution – Proactively identify potential issues during the NPI phase and develop solutions to address them. Implement strategies to prevent future issues and ensure a smooth product launch.
